Books on Reserve are located behind the circulation desk. You may check these out for two hours while in the library, or (with an approved e-mail to the Librarians on staff from your professor) check them out for a designated amount of time, as instructed by your professor, outside of the library.
An open book is a type of open educational resource designed to be a free or low-cost substitute for a traditional book or textbook.
